
The Work Exchange Team (WET) is a program that allows you to experience Harvest Festival from the working side, while gaining entrance to the event in exchange for your work! An online $200 deposit, equal to the amount of a weekend pass plus a cancellation fee, are required to become a WET member along with a non-refundable application fee. Applications are released via email.
Applications to become a WET member for the Harvest Music Festival are accepted until all positions are filled. You may apply by clicking here. Please note that there is a $15 non-refundable application processing fee to apply to become a WET member.
We prefer that all applicants apply before the festival, however applicants with credit card deposits are accepted at the gate if, and only if, positions are still available.
In order to become a WET member for the Harvest Music Festival, you must complete the online application. Once accepted, you are required to submit a deposit via credit card/check card in the amount of $200 (the price of a ticket with camping) to secure your spot. The deposit is applied immediately when you submit your credit card information, held throughout the festival, and released after the festival pending completion of your volunteer hours.
All applicants are notified of their status within 2 weeks via their "My Events" section on the WET website.
WET members receive admission to the festival, camping, WET t-shirt, and an amazing experience. Water is available to WET members while on shift.
WET members will perform a variety of tasks to assist in the festival’s success. Departments include: Clean Up, Parking, Merchandise, VIP, Catering, Production and many more! A WET member may be asked to switch departments as last minute changes surface. Any task in which a WET member is not physically capable of performing should be noted by the WET member to the supervisor and the WET member are deferred to another task. All tasks are supervised.
All WET members must work an average minimum of 15 hours for admission to the festival. If you are selected for Pre-festival work and you complete all you’re your hours before the festival starts, a minimum of 20 hours are required.
If a WET coordinator feels that a volunteer is under the influence of alcohol or illegal drugs and cannot perform the assigned duties, the volunteer are relieved of duties and forfeit their WET deposit. Absolutely no exceptions are made or discussed.
You may choose on your application your top three bands that you prefer not to miss but please note that we will try our best to honor your request, but there is no guarantee that you will not be working during your top three bands. Most night shifts are located inside the music festival concert area.
NO, unfortunately purchased tickets cannot be refunded. All WET members must make their deposit through the WET website in order to volunteer.
Potential WET members should mark on their applications to signify whether or not they are available to work before or after the festival starts. You are notified beforehand if we have a pre festival position available. Please note that this does not mean that you will complete all of your shifts before the festival starts. You may be required to also work during the festival.
WET members must be at least 18 years or older.
Schedules are determined by festival labor needs, past experience, friend requests, band requests and any other appropriate factors. You must expect to work at lease one night shift during the festival days. Unless you have been requested by a specific department head, please do not email us requesting certain shifts or departments.
After you fill out the WET application and have been accepted through the WET website, you will have to submit a $200 deposit online via credit card/check card. After you have submitted your deposit information, you are confirmed as a WET volunteer.
ONLY credit cards/check cards are accepted prior to the event.
Once it has been confirmed that you have completed your obligation for admission to the festival, we will release your deposit. (Within 5 - 10 business days after the festival)
If you register to become a WET member and are accepted, but do not show up to work a shift or even show up at the festival at all, you will forfeit your WET deposit and your credit card will not be credited.
